Myths In Motion – Songs Of Ivory And Obsidian
The SECOND of two double albums
The two records within this release are two very different sides of the same coin – one is electric, energetic, heavy and progressive, while the other is acoustic, haunting and melancholic, with piano, (real) string sections, choirs and classical percussion.
The brand new Progressive Metal double-album, featuring 19 songs and more than 1,5 hours of music, will be released on 2 CDs and as a luxury 3-LP trifold package, with inlays featuring full artwork, lyrics and liner notes. The vinyl edition is limited to 250 copies.

Both albums will be released on SEPTEMBER 5TH 2024 and feature:
Tim ‘Ripper’ Owens (Judas Priest, Iced Earth, KK’s Priest,...)
Damian Wilson (Ayreon, Star One, Threshold, Arena,...)
Tom Englund (Evergrey)
Roy Khan (Conception, Kamelot)
Thomas Vikström (Therion,...)
Georg Neuhauser (Serenity)
Henrik Fevre (Anubis Gate)
Arno Menses (Subsignal, Sieges Even)
Nick Holleman (Powerized)
John Yelland (Judicator)
Sindre Nedland (In Vain)
Jeffrey Rademakers (Spartan)
Audrey Dandeville (Irradiance)
Benny ‘Zors’ Willaert (23 Acez, Thorium)
Louis Soenens (Aeveris, Fields of Troy)
Anneleen Olbrechts (Thorium)
Lynn Louise Pauwels (Kayamandi)
Mixed and mastered by Simone Mularoni
Out September 5th 2024 on Freya Records
